Brief Summary  

India reportedly has the highest prevalence of suicide in Southeast Asia with a reported prevalence of 11.3 per 100,000 population in 2020, much higher than the global average (Menon et al, 2023). Emerging evidence suggests that iTBS exhibits superior clinical efficacy in managing major depressive disorder (MDD) when contrasted with traditional rTMS approaches (Di Lazzaro et al., 2011; Chung et al., 2015; Prasser et al., 2015). A notable advantage of TBS is its reduced administration duration relative to conventional rTMS procedures. The rTMS applied to bilateral right-sided cTBS and left-sided iTBS of the DLPFC in major unipolar depression is regarded as a probable, Level B recommendation whereas unilateral right-sided cTBS is possibly ineffective Level C. Research has explored the potential therapeutic benefits of modulating Brain-Derived Neurotrophic Factor (BDNF) levels through Repetitive Transcranial Magnetic Stimulation (rTMS) in the context of depression (Chen et al,2017, Numbero et al, 2021). HR variability is proposed as a novel cardiovascular biomarker. (Sheen et al, 2022). Previous studies have compared High-frequency rTMS vs Low-frequency rTMS for assessing neurocognitive decline, clinical improvement, and suicide risk. One study has evaluated the levels of BDNF in augmented repetitive transcranial magnetic stimulation using high-frequency rTMS (4).

However, as per our analysis, most reported studies have only followed antidepressant effects for 4 weeks (18). Ours will have an 8-week follow-up period and attempt to assess the response to an aITBS session. This will help identify response rates and frequency intervals for aiTBS sessions. There have been limited reported studies comparing the clinical efficacy of two different protocols of accelerated iTBS and a few ongoing trials that are using both - heart rate variability and serum BDNF levels in patients diagnosed with depression and their potential role as biomarkers in indication treatment response.
